Artificial Intelligence (AI) practical codes and lab assignments for SPPU AI & DS 2019 Pattern Semester 5
This repository contains all practical codes for the Artificial Intelligence (Group B) lab, including implementations of classic AI search algorithms and problem-solving techniques based on the 2019 Pattern syllabus for Savitribai Phule Pune University (SPPU).
- Depth First Search (DFS)
- Breadth First Search (BFS)
- Implemented using an undirected graph with recursive traversal for exploring all vertices.
- A* (A-Star) Algorithm
- Applied to a game search or shortest path problem.
- Alpha-Beta Pruning
- Optimized search strategy for two-player games.
- Branch & Bound and Backtracking
- Demonstrated using N-Queens or Graph Coloring problem.
- Greedy strategies implemented for:
- Selection Sort
- Minimum Spanning Tree (Prim’s / Kruskal’s Algorithm)
- Single-Source Shortest Path (Dijkstra’s Algorithm)
- Job Scheduling Problem
